Re: Benchies with Kingston V300 120GB SSD
On several new Haswell based systems, I ran benchmarks on them...
Sandra
CDM
HD Tune
HD Tach
AS SSD
ATTO
Performance Test
Most of them had the SSD's maxing the read out between 250 and 300MB/s and 100 and 150MB/s write. ATTO and Performance Test had read 500 - 520MB/s and 125 - 150MB/s write..
